What Whiteflies Are and Why They're Hard to Get Rid Of

Whiteflies aren't actually flies. They're soft-bodied piercing-sucking insects related to aphids and scale. The two species you'll encounter most often are the greenhouse whitefly (Trialeurodes vaporariorum) and the silverleaf whitefly (Bemisia tabaci), also called the sweet potato whitefly.
Adults look like tiny white moths about 1/16 inch long. They feed on plant sap by piercing leaf tissue and sucking out phloem, which weakens the plant and transmits diseases like Tomato Yellow Leaf Curl Virus. As they feed, they excrete a sticky substance called honeydew that coats lower leaves and encourages black sooty mold growth.
The real problem is their life cycle. A single female lays 200 to 400 eggs on the undersides of leaves. Those eggs hatch into nymphs that look like flat, translucent scales.
Nymphs don't move. They just sit and feed for about two weeks before pupating and emerging as adults.
Why single treatments fail:
- Contact sprays (soap, oil, pyrethrin) only kill adults and mobile nymphs, not eggs or late-stage pupae.
- Eggs hatch over several days, so new nymphs appear after you spray.
- If you stop treatment too early, even a few survivors restart the cycle.
- Adults fly to nearby plants, so treating just one infested plant leaves a reservoir.
Most gardeners spray once, see improvement, and quit. Two weeks later the population is back because eggs hatched after the first treatment. You need repeat applications timed to the hatch cycle.
How to Tell If You Actually Have Whiteflies (Not Another Pest)

Before you start any treatment, confirm you're dealing with whiteflies and not aphids, mealybugs, or fungus gnats. The identification is straightforward once you know what to look for.
The shake test:
Gently shake or tap an affected plant. If a cloud of tiny white insects flies up and then settles back down, you have whiteflies. Aphids don't fly.
Mealybugs don't fly. Fungus gnats fly but they're dark and hang around soil, not leaves.
Check leaf undersides:
Flip over a few leaves and look closely. You'll see three things if whiteflies are present.
- Tiny white oval adults, usually clustered near veins.
- Pale yellow or white eggs standing upright, almost like grains of rice but microscopic.
- Flat, translucent or yellow-green nymphs that look like scale insects.
Look for honeydew and sooty mold:
Run your finger along the top of a lower leaf. If it feels sticky, that's honeydew. Black powdery coating on top of the stickiness is sooty mold, a secondary fungus that grows on the sugar-rich excretion.
Check for leaf damage:
Whitefly feeding causes stippling (tiny yellow dots), general yellowing, leaf curling, and stunted new growth. Heavy infestations lead to leaf drop and reduced fruit set on vegetables.
Indoor plants, especially houseplants in low-light spots, can harbor whiteflies year-round. Outdoor gardens in warm climates see higher pressure during summer and fall.
How Bad Is Your Infestation? Light, Moderate, or Severe
Treatment strategy changes completely depending on population size. Assess honestly before you pick a method, because using a light-touch approach on a severe infestation wastes time and lets the problem get worse.
| Infestation Level | What You See | Adult Count (Shake Test) | Leaf Damage |
|---|---|---|---|
| Light | A few adults fly up when disturbed; small clusters of nymphs on a few leaves | Under 10 adults per plant | Minimal yellowing, no leaf drop |
| Moderate | Dozens of adults; nymphs visible on most leaves; sticky honeydew present | 10-50 adults per plant | Noticeable yellowing, some curling, sooty mold starting |
| Severe | Hundreds of adults; nymphs coat undersides; heavy honeydew; black sooty mold | 50+ adults per plant | Severe yellowing, leaf drop, stunted growth, plant declining |
When to check:
Early morning or late evening when adults are less active. They hide on undersides during the heat of the day, so midday inspections can underestimate the problem.
Where to check:
Focus on new growth and the undersides of mid-level leaves. Whiteflies prefer tender tissue. Outdoor gardeners should check plants near doors, vents, or other entry points first, since that's where indoor infestations often start.
If you're seeing adults but no nymphs or eggs, you've caught it very early or the population just arrived. That's the easiest scenario. If you see all three life stages (eggs, nymphs, adults), you're dealing with an established colony that's been reproducing for at least two weeks.
Treatment Path for Light Infestations (Just Started Noticing Them)
Light infestations respond well to non-chemical methods and gentle contact sprays. The goal here is to knock down the population before it explodes, using the least disruptive tools first.
Water Spray and Manual Removal
For indoor plants or a small outdoor garden, a strong water spray dislodges adults and nymphs. This works best if you've only got a few affected plants.
How to do it:
Take the plant outside or to a sink. Use a spray nozzle or hose set to a firm but not damaging stream. Spray the undersides of every leaf, top to bottom.
The water physically removes adults and nymphs.
Frequency:
Every 2 to 3 days for two weeks. Whiteflies can't reattach once knocked off, but eggs will still hatch, so you need repeat sessions.
Limitations:
Water spray doesn't kill eggs. It's a mechanical removal method, not a pesticide. It works well as part of a layered approach but rarely solves a problem on its own unless the infestation is truly minimal.
For plants with very soft leaves (like some indoor flowering plants), use a gentler stream or skip this method entirely to avoid tissue damage.
Yellow Sticky Traps

Yellow sticky traps catch adult whiteflies. Adults are attracted to the bright yellow color, land on the adhesive surface, and get stuck. Traps don't kill nymphs or eggs, but they reduce the number of breeding adults and give you a real-time population monitor.
Where to place them:
Hang traps just above the plant canopy or among the foliage. Whiteflies fly weakly and tend to stay near their host plant, so traps need to be close. For a potted tomato or pepper, one trap per plant is enough.
In a garden bed, space traps every 3 to 4 feet.
How many:
Start with 1 trap per affected plant indoors, 1 per 10 square feet outdoors.
How often to replace:
Check traps every few days. When the surface is covered with insects or debris, swap in a fresh one. A trap loses effectiveness once it's too full to catch more.
What traps tell you:
If you're seeing dozens of new whiteflies on a trap each day, your infestation is worse than you thought. If trap catch drops to just a few per day after a week, your other treatments are working.
Traps are passive. They help but don't replace active treatment. Think of them as part of an integrated approach, not a standalone fix.
Insecticidal Soap Application
Insecticidal soap kills soft-bodied insects on contact by disrupting cell membranes. It's one of the safest and most effective tools for light to moderate whitefly pressure, especially on edible plants.
What it kills:
Adults and nymphs. It does not kill eggs or late-stage pupae that are encased in a protective coating.
How to apply:
Mix according to label directions (usually 2 to 5 tablespoons per gallon of water). Spray every leaf surface, top and bottom, until runoff. The spray must make direct contact with the insect to work.
Application timing:
Early morning or late evening when temperatures are below 80°F. Soap can cause leaf burn in hot sun or on heat-stressed plants.
Frequency:
Every 5 to 7 days for at least two weeks. You're targeting new nymphs as they hatch from eggs that survived the last spray.
Plant safety:
Test on a small section of the plant first. Some varieties (ferns, succulents, certain herbs) can show phytotoxicity. Wait 24 hours and check for browning or spotting before treating the whole plant.
Pre-harvest interval:
Most insecticidal soaps have little to no pre-harvest restriction, but always check the label. You can typically harvest and wash vegetables the same day you spray.
Insecticidal soap works well for indoor plants where you want to avoid stronger chemicals. It breaks down quickly, leaves no residue, and won't harm pets or people once it dries.
Treatment Path for Moderate Infestations (Lots of Adults, Visible Nymphs)
When you're seeing dozens of adults per plant, clusters of nymphs on most leaves, and sticky honeydew coating lower foliage, water spray and soap alone won't cut it. You need stronger contact treatments and a disciplined spray schedule.
Neem Oil or Horticultural Oil Sprays
Neem oil and horticultural oil both work by smothering insects and disrupting their feeding and reproduction. They're more persistent than insecticidal soap and add some systemic activity (neem is absorbed into leaf tissue and affects insects that feed on treated leaves).
Neem oil:
Extracted from neem tree seeds, neem oil contains azadirachtin, a compound that disrupts insect molting and reproduction. It kills adults and nymphs on contact and has a residual effect that lasts several days.
Horticultural oil:
Refined petroleum or plant-based oil that coats and suffocates insects. It works purely by physical action, no chemical toxicity.
How to apply:
Mix according to label directions (neem is typically 1 to 2 tablespoons per gallon; horticultural oil varies by product). Spray to runoff, covering all leaf surfaces. Oils need direct contact to work.
Application timing:
Spray in early morning or evening. Never apply oils in full sun or when temperatures exceed 85°F. Oil can magnify sunlight and burn leaves.
Frequency:
Every 7 days for three weeks minimum. Neem's residual activity lasts about 5 to 7 days, so weekly applications keep pressure on new hatchlings.
Advantages over soap:
Oils stick to leaves longer and provide some protection between sprays. Neem also has mild fungicidal properties, which helps if sooty mold has started.
Limitations:
Oils can injure sensitive plants (some ferns, blue-needled conifers, and succulents). Always test a small area first. Don't use horticultural oil on plants already stressed by drought or heat.
For outdoor vegetables like tomatoes and peppers, neem oil is a solid choice. It's approved for organic production and has a zero-day pre-harvest interval on most crops, meaning you can spray and harvest the same day (rinse produce before eating).
Pyrethrin-Based Sprays
Pyrethrins are natural insecticides derived from chrysanthemum flowers. They kill a broad range of insects quickly by attacking their nervous systems. For whiteflies, pyrethrins deliver fast knockdown of adults.
What pyrethrins kill:
Adults and mobile nymphs. They have little to no effect on eggs.
How to apply:
Follow label directions. Most pyrethrin sprays are ready-to-use or require minimal dilution. Spray all plant surfaces, especially undersides where nymphs cluster.
Speed:
Pyrethrins work within minutes. You'll see adults drop immediately after contact.
Persistence:
Pyrethrins break down rapidly in sunlight, usually within 24 hours. That's good for safety but means you need repeat applications.
Frequency:
Every 5 to 7 days for two to three weeks. The short residual means you're relying on direct contact each time you spray.
Organic status:
Pyrethrins are approved for organic gardening, but some formulations include synthetic synergists (like piperonyl butoxide) that are not organic-approved. Read labels carefully if certification matters.
Cautions:
Pyrethrins are toxic to bees, beneficial insects, and aquatic life. Spray only in early morning or late evening when pollinators aren't active. Avoid spray drift into ponds or streams.
Don't use pyrethrins on plants that attract hummingbirds or other beneficial visitors unless absolutely necessary.
Pyrethrin sprays are a good fit for moderate outdoor infestations where you need fast results and can time applications to minimize non-target impacts.
How Often to Spray and Why Timing Matters
The whitefly life cycle drives your spray schedule. If you don't align treatments with egg hatch and nymph development, you'll leave survivors that restart the colony.
Egg stage:
Lasts 5 to 7 days. Eggs are resistant to most contact sprays.
Nymph stage:
Lasts 10 to 14 days. Early nymphs (crawlers) are vulnerable. Late-stage nymphs and pupae are harder to kill because they develop a waxy coating.
Adult stage:
Lives 30 to 40 days, laying eggs continuously.
Spray interval logic:
If you spray today, you kill adults and early nymphs but not eggs. Those eggs hatch in 5 to 7 days. If you spray again in 7 days, you catch the newly hatched nymphs before they mature.
A third spray 7 days later catches any stragglers or eggs that hatched late.
Minimum treatment duration:
Two full weeks (three applications spaced 5 to 7 days apart). Three weeks is better. Stopping after one or two sprays is the most common mistake.
Temperature matters:
Whiteflies develop faster in warm conditions. At 80°F, the full cycle takes about 18 days. At 70°F, it stretches to 30 days.
In cooler weather, space treatments slightly farther apart (every 7 to 10 days). In hot weather, tighten the interval to every 5 days.
Mark your calendar. Set phone reminders. Treating on a consistent schedule is the difference between success and frustration.
Treatment Path for Severe Infestations (Leaves Covered, Plant Declining)
Severe infestations need systemic insecticides or a combination of contact and systemic treatments. At this stage, adults number in the hundreds, nymphs cover entire leaf undersides, and plants show heavy stress from feeding damage and sooty mold.
Systemic Insecticides: When and How to Use Them
Systemic insecticides are absorbed into plant tissue and kill insects that feed on the plant over several weeks. They're the most effective option when populations have exploded and contact sprays can't keep up.
Common active ingredients:
Imidacloprid and dinotefuran (neonicotinoids) are the two most widely available systemics for whiteflies. Both are sold as soil drenches or granules you mix into potting soil.
How they work:
You water the product into the soil around the plant's root zone. The roots absorb the chemical and distribute it through the vascular system. When whiteflies feed on leaves, they ingest the insecticide and die within days.
Application method:
Mix the concentrate according to label directions (typically 1 to 2 teaspoons per gallon for imidacloprid). Pour the solution around the base of the plant until the root zone is saturated. For potted plants, apply until liquid drains from the bottom.
How long it takes:
You'll see reduced adult activity within 3 to 5 days. Full control takes 7 to 14 days as the chemical moves through the plant and reaches all feeding sites.
Frequency:
One application usually lasts 8 to 12 weeks. Most labels allow a second application if needed, but read restrictions carefully.
Restrictions:
Do not use neonicotinoids on plants that flower and attract pollinators. Imidacloprid is toxic to bees and persists in pollen and nectar. For edibles, check pre-harvest intervals (often 21 days or more).
Never use systemics on herbs you'll harvest within three weeks.
Systemic insecticides are a last-resort tool for ornamentals and non-flowering vegetables. They're overkill for light infestations and come with environmental trade-offs, but they work when nothing else does.
Combining Methods for Heavy Pressure
Severe infestations respond best to a layered approach. Use a systemic for long-term control and a contact spray to knock down the adult population immediately.
Example combo:
Apply imidacloprid as a soil drench on day one. Spray neem oil or pyrethrin on day two to kill visible adults. The contact spray gives fast relief while the systemic builds up in plant tissue.
Why this works:
The systemic handles eggs and newly hatched nymphs over the next two weeks. The contact spray reduces the number of adults laying new eggs right now. Together, they hit every life stage.
Follow-up:
Continue weekly contact sprays for two weeks after the systemic application. This catches any adults that survived the first spray and prevents reinfestation from nearby plants.
Don't skip the contact spray phase. Systemics take time to reach effective levels, and during that window, adults keep reproducing.
Indoor Plants vs Outdoor Gardens: How Treatment Changes
Treatment strategy shifts depending on where your plants are growing. Indoor and outdoor environments present different challenges and different tool options.
Indoor plants:
You're dealing with a closed environment. Whiteflies can't fly away, but they also can't be eaten by natural predators. Contact sprays (soap, neem) work well because you can treat every plant in the room and control reinfestation.
Avoid pyrethrins and synthetic insecticides indoors unless you can ventilate heavily. Stick with low-odor options like insecticidal soap. Quarantine any new plants for two weeks before placing them near established ones.
Check undersides before you buy.
Outdoor gardens:
Larger plant populations and open air make treatment harder, but you've got beneficial insects working in your favor. Yellow sticky traps catch more adults outdoors because wind and plant movement stir them up.
If you're growing vegetables, avoid broad-spectrum insecticides that kill ladybugs, lacewings, and parasitic wasps. These predators provide free pest control if you let them. Use neem or soap first, and save pyrethrins or systemics for situations where organic methods fail.
Greenhouses:
Greenhouses combine the worst of both worlds. High humidity and warmth speed up whitefly reproduction. Limited airflow means populations concentrate quickly.
Use biological controls (covered below) whenever possible, because chemical sprays can build up in enclosed air and harm workers or plants.
Temperature also matters. Outdoor whiteflies slow down when fall temperatures drop below 50°F. Indoor plants can harbor them year-round, so winter is when houseplants become the biggest problem.
Biological Controls: Using Natural Predators That Actually Work

Biological control means releasing insects that eat or parasitize whiteflies. This works best in greenhouses or large outdoor gardens where predator populations can establish and reproduce.
Encarsia formosa:
A tiny parasitic wasp (smaller than a pinhead) that lays eggs inside whitefly nymphs. The wasp larva develops inside the nymph, killing it. Parasitized nymphs turn black, a clear sign the wasps are working.
How to use them:
Purchase cards or vials of Encarsia from biological control suppliers. Hang cards among infested plants. Wasps emerge over 2 to 3 weeks and start hunting immediately.
Best conditions:
Temperatures between 70°F and 80°F, moderate humidity, and no recent pesticide applications (most insecticides kill Encarsia). Release rates vary, but a common starting point is 5 to 10 wasps per infested plant, repeated every two weeks.
Delphastus catalinae:
A tiny black beetle (also called the whitefly predator beetle) that eats whitefly eggs and nymphs. Adults and larvae both feed on whiteflies. One beetle can consume hundreds of eggs and nymphs over its lifetime.
Release rates:
2 to 5 beetles per infested plant, repeated weekly for three weeks in heavy infestations.
Lacewings and ladybugs:
Both prey on whitefly nymphs, but they're generalists and will leave if whitefly populations drop or other food is available. They're helpful as part of an integrated approach but don't rely on them alone.
Limitations:
Biological controls take time. Expect 4 to 6 weeks before you see significant population reduction. They don't work well for small indoor plant collections, because predator populations need a steady food supply to survive.
They're most effective in commercial greenhouses or large hobby gardens where you can sustain a release program.
Never spray insecticides (even organic ones like neem or pyrethrin) within two weeks of releasing beneficials. The spray kills your helpers along with the pests.
The Biggest Mistakes People Make (and Why Treatments Fail)
Most whitefly treatment failures come down to timing, coverage, or giving up too early. Here's what goes wrong and how to avoid it.
Stopping after one spray:
You see fewer adults, assume the problem is solved, and quit. Eggs hatch a week later, and you're back where you started. Always complete at least three applications spaced 5 to 7 days apart.
Missing leaf undersides:
Nymphs and eggs live on the undersides. If you only spray tops, you're missing 90% of the population. Flip leaves up and spray from below, or use a spray wand that lets you reach undersides without awkward angles.
Treating one plant while ignoring others:
Whiteflies fly. If you treat your tomato but ignore the pepper plant next to it, adults just move over and restart the colony. Treat every susceptible plant in the area at the same time.
Using the wrong product for the situation:
Contact sprays don't kill eggs. Systemics take a week to work. Biological controls need time and the right environment.
Match the tool to the infestation stage and your growing conditions.
Spraying in the middle of the day:
Hot sun and high temperatures cause leaf burn when you use oils or soaps. Spray early morning or evening when temps are below 80°F and the sun isn't intense.
Not cleaning up fallen leaves:
Whiteflies can pupate on leaf litter under the plant. Rake up and dispose of dropped leaves to eliminate hiding spots.
Whitefly control is a process, not an event. Expect to stay on top of it for three weeks minimum, and monitor for another month after you think you've won.
How Long It Really Takes to Eliminate Whiteflies
Complete elimination takes 3 to 4 weeks with a disciplined treatment schedule. Here's a realistic timeline based on starting infestation level.
Light infestation (under 10 adults per plant):
Week 1: Water spray and sticky traps, daily monitoring.
Week 2: Apply insecticidal soap twice (days 7 and 14).
Week 3: Monitor traps. If catch drops to zero for three consecutive days, you're clear.
Total time: 2 to 3 weeks.
Moderate infestation (10 to 50 adults per plant):
Week 1: Neem oil spray on days 1 and 7, sticky traps in place.
Week 2: Second and third neem applications (days 14 and 21).
Week 3: Monitor. Apply a fourth spray if new adults appear.
Total time: 3 to 4 weeks.
Severe infestation (50+ adults per plant):
Day 1: Systemic soil drench (imidacloprid).
Days 2, 9, 16: Contact spray (pyrethrin or neem) to knock down adults.
Weeks 2 to 4: Monitor sticky traps. Systemic provides residual control.
Total time: 4 to 6 weeks, sometimes longer if plants are heavily stressed.
Maintenance phase:
After you've cleared visible adults and sticky traps stay clean for a week, continue monitoring for another two weeks. Check undersides weekly. One or two survivors can restart the cycle if conditions are right.
If you're still seeing significant numbers after four weeks of treatment, reassess your approach. You might be missing coverage, skipping applications, or dealing with reinfestation from an untreated source nearby.
Preventing Reinfestation After You've Cleared Them
Once you've eliminated an active infestation, prevention keeps them from coming back. Whiteflies reappear when you introduce infested plants or when adults fly in from nearby sources.
Quarantine new plants:
Inspect any plant before you bring it home. Check undersides for nymphs, eggs, or adults. Isolate new arrivals for two weeks in a separate room or area.
If whiteflies appear during quarantine, treat before moving the plant near others.
Monitor weekly:
Check your plants every 7 to 10 days even when you don't see problems. Early detection stops small populations before they explode. Yellow sticky traps left in place year-round catch the first scouts.
Improve airflow:
Whiteflies prefer still air and dense foliage. Space plants farther apart indoors. Prune overcrowded branches on outdoor plants.
Use a small fan in grow rooms to keep air moving.
Avoid over-fertilizing:
Excess nitrogen creates lush, soft growth that whiteflies love. Stick to balanced feeding schedules and avoid pushing plants too hard with high-nitrogen fertilizers.
Outdoor gardeners should clear garden debris in fall. Whiteflies overwinter on plant residue in warm climates. Remove spent vegetable plants and weeds that serve as alternate hosts.
Safety Considerations for Edible Plants, Pets, and Indoor Use
Different treatments carry different safety profiles. Choose products that match your situation and follow label restrictions carefully.
Edible crops:
Insecticidal soap and horticultural oil have zero-day or one-day pre-harvest intervals on most vegetables. Neem oil varies (usually zero to three days). Always rinse produce under running water before eating, even if the label says no waiting period.
Imidacloprid and other systemics have pre-harvest intervals of 21 days or longer. Don't use them on herbs, leafy greens, or anything you'll harvest within a month. Read the label for each crop.
Tomatoes, peppers, and cucumbers have different restrictions than lettuce or basil.
Pets and children:
Insecticidal soap and neem oil are low-toxicity once dry. Keep pets and kids away during application and until leaves dry (usually 2 to 4 hours). Pyrethrin sprays are more toxic.
Don't let pets chew treated leaves.
Systemic soil drenches (imidacloprid) can be toxic to pets if they dig in treated soil or drink runoff water. Apply when pets are indoors, and water in thoroughly so the product binds to soil particles.
Indoor air quality:
Avoid aerosol sprays indoors. Pump sprayers give you better control and less airborne drift. Open windows during and after treatment.
Run exhaust fans if available.
Store all pesticides in original containers, out of reach of children and pets. Dispose of empty containers per local regulations. Never pour leftovers down drains or into storm sewers.
When to Cut Your Losses and Remove the Plant
Sometimes a plant is too far gone to save, or the effort to treat it exceeds its value. Here's when removal makes more sense than continued treatment.
The plant is dying:
If more than half the leaves have dropped, growth has stopped, and the plant shows no new green tissue after two weeks of treatment, it's not coming back. Compost it (hot compost only) or bag and trash it.
It's a chronic source:
One heavily infested plant that keeps reinfecting others becomes a liability. If you've treated it three times and whiteflies keep rebounding while other plants stay clear, remove the problem plant to protect the rest.
It's a low-value ornamental:
A $5 annual that would cost $20 in time and products to treat isn't worth saving. Replace it with a healthy plant and move on.
For vegetables near harvest, weigh the remaining yield against treatment cost and safety. A tomato plant with three weeks left might be worth a systemic drench. A pepper plant with two fruit and heavy whitefly damage probably isn't.
Dispose of removed plants carefully. Don't leave them on the compost pile unless your compost reaches 140°F. Bag them and put them in household trash, or bury them away from the garden.
Quick Decision Guide: What to Use Based on Your Situation
Pick your treatment path based on infestation level, plant type, and location. Use this guide to skip straight to the method that fits.
| Your Situation | Best First Treatment | Follow-Up | Timeline |
|---|---|---|---|
| Few adults, indoor houseplants | Water spray + sticky traps | Insecticidal soap weekly x3 | 2-3 weeks |
| Moderate infestation, outdoor vegetables | Neem oil spray | Repeat every 7 days x3 | 3 weeks |
| Heavy infestation, ornamentals | Imidacloprid soil drench + pyrethrin spray | Weekly contact spray x2 | 4 weeks |
| Greenhouse, ongoing problem | Release Encarsia formosa | Repeat releases every 2 weeks | 6-8 weeks |
| Edible herbs, light infestation | Insecticidal soap | Repeat every 5 days x3 | 2 weeks |
If one approach isn't working after two weeks, escalate. Move from soap to neem, or from neem to a systemic. Don't keep repeating a method that's failing.
